Méthode IModelObject ::GetTargetInfo (dbgmodel.h)
La méthode GetTargetInfo est en fait une combinaison des méthodes GetLocation et GetTypeInfo qui retournent à la fois l’emplacement abstrait et le type natif de l’objet donné.
Syntaxe
HRESULT GetTargetInfo(
Location *location,
IDebugHostType **type
);
Paramètres
location
L’emplacement abstrait de l’objet natif représenté par ce pointeur sera retourné ici.
type
Le type natif de l’objet représenté par ce pointeur est retourné ici en tant qu’interface IDebugHostType .
Valeur retournée
Cette méthode retourne HRESULT qui indique la réussite ou l’échec.
Remarques
Exemple de code
ComPtr<IModelObject> spObject; /* get an object */
Location loc;
ComPtr<IDebugHostType> spType;
if (SUCCEEDED(spObject->GetTargetInfo(&loc, &spType)))
{
// loc has a valid location
// spType has a valid type -- the type of the object
}
Configuration requise
Condition requise | Valeur |
---|---|
En-tête | dbgmodel.h |
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our